Is the 2011 C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OT reliable?
Average reliability. Expect some repairs as it ages. That's 11 points below the national average of 82%.
At 13 years old, 71% of C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OTs from 2011 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 127 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 101,344 miles.

2011 C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OT Fuel Costs
The 2359cc diesel engine offers a reasonable balance between performance and economy. Expect around 40 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,245 per year at current diesel prices of 148p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year). Diesel cars of this age should have their DPF (diesel particulate filter) checked, as replacements can be costly.
What does it cost to own a 2011 C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OT?
Total estimated annual running cost is £2,050 (£171/month), broken down as £1245 fuel, £250 road tax, £55 MOT, and £500 predicted repairs. Repair costs are moderate, reflecting the 71% pass rate. Keeping on top of servicing will help avoid surprises.

Buying a Used 2011 C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OT
At 13 years old, the CHRYSLER-JEEP PATRIOT is firmly in budget territory. Purchase prices are low, but check for rust, worn suspension bushes, and electrical gremlins. A full service history is especially valuable at this age.
